The Pioneer Mustangs are taking a road trip to face off against the Leigh Longhorns at 2:30 p.m. on Saturday. Leigh took a loss in their last match and will be looking to turn the tables on Pioneer, who comes in off a win.
Pioneer was handed a 28-point loss in their previous outing, but that didn't affect their clutch gene on Thursday. They sure made it a nail-biter, but they managed to escape with a 56-53 victory over Leland. The win continues a trend for the Mustangs in their matchups with the Chargers: they've now won five in a row.
Meanwhile, Leigh ended up a good deal behind Westmont on Thursday and lost 46-29.
Pioneer will need to focus on slowing down Cali Wallace, one of several Leigh players who made an impact when they last played. She posted nine points. The team also got some help courtesy of Demi Dobrila, who scored six points.
Even though they lost, Leigh smashed the offensive glass and finished the game with 11 offensive boards. That strong performance was nothing new for the team: they've now pulled down at least nine offensive rebounds in eight consecutive games.
Leigh now has a losing record of 11-12. As for Pioneer, their victory bumped their record up to 10-12.
Pioneer beat Leigh 43-30 when the teams last played back in February of 2022. The rematch might be a little tougher for Pioneer since the team won't have the home-court advantage this time around. We'll see if the change in venue makes a difference.
